U.S.-led resolution calling for cease-fire in Gaza vetoed at U.N. Security Council

Image source - Pexels.com

Secretary of State Antony Blinken met with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u Friday to discuss the latest in a potential cease-fire with Hamas. Meanwhile, a U.S.-sponsored resolution at the United Nations Security Council calling for an “immediate and sustained cease-fire” was vetoed by Russia and China.
